Hi!
I wrote an orchestral piece in Finale 26. Today, when I open the file, in the Scroll View the notation not appear, only on the Page View. When I try to write anything in Scroll View, the programme says there is an error and the program will be closed. What can I do? Why this error?

As an experiment, save the file as XML (File > Export > Music XML). Open the XML in Finale and see if the problem is gone. If your original file is corrupt, this might be the only way to save it.

You might also want to attach a copy of the file to this forum so others can troubleshoot. Just a few pages might do.

You wrote that you tried to make a new file but the problem persisted. How did you create the new file? From the Wizard, from a template, from scratch?

As N wrote, the best way to troubleshoot the document is if we can see it. If you are not comfortable sharing the music, try this. On a COPY of the piece clear everything and see if the problem persists. If it does, then post that empty document here.

I saved the file as XML and now is ok. I think the problem is the file is very big. I don't know.
